Smilodon is a genus of felids belonging to the extinct subfamily Machairodontinae. It is one of the best known saber-toothed predators and prehistoric mammals. Although commonly known as the saber-toothed tiger, it was not closely related to the tiger or other modern cats.Abstract. Saber-toothed cats (Machairodontinae) are among the most widely recognized representatives of the now largely extinct Pleistocene megafauna. However, many aspects of their ecology, evolution, and extinction remain uncertain. Although ancient-DNA studies have led to huge advances in our knowledge of these aspects of many other ...For millions of years, Southern California was covered in woodland, where large mammals such as saber-toothed cats, dire wolves, and camels roamed. New radiocarbon dates from the La Brea Tar Pits suggest these big animals began to disappear about 13,200 years ago, just when charcoal and pollen from a nearby lake suggest rampant wildfires.

The Hyaenodontidae, a family of the extinct mammalian order Creodonta, also included saber-toothed members. Saber–toothed cat facts. The saber–toothed cats or sabretooth cats are some of the best known and most popular extinct animals. They are among the most impressive carnivores that ever have lived. These cats had long canines and jaws which opened wider than modern cats. During the last Ice Age, there were many large, interesting mammals, like the saber-toothed cats, giant ground sloths, mastodons, and mammoths. These animals have long since gone extinct and are known mostly from fossils, from frozen, mummified carcasses, and even from ancient cave drawings. Searching for the Genes That Make ...Smilodon is first known from the Pliocene of North America and was one of the last sabertooth species to go extinct at the end of the Pleistocene. Although Smilodon and Homotherium are both sabertooth cats, morphologically, these two species are very distinct. These two extinct cats can be grouped into scimitar-toothed and dirk-toothed cats 2, 3.
